
HOW TO STICK TO YOUR FITNESS GOALS FOR GOOD
As the new year approaches, New Years resolutions are made and broken. But it doesn’t have to be that way. Your fitness goals are well within reach when you follow a few basic steps.
Set Realistic Goals
Set fitness goals that are realistic and achievable. Most people set grandiose goals only to see them fizzle away because they are set too high. Set goals slightly outside your immediate reach. This way you are always challenging yourself. Adjust your goals as you become stronger.
Find A Buddy
Don’t do it alone. Research confirms that people who workout with somebody else are more likely to accomplish a workout goal than those who work out alone. If you don’t have an accountability partner, consider joining a gym.

Preparation is Critical
Prepare for the times you want to quit. This may seem counter-intuitive, but when you have a plan for what you will do when you feel like quitting (and you will) chances are better that you won’t. As you begin to see your personal transformation your desire to continue will grow as your waistline decreases.
Set yourself up to succeed. That means prepare for the gym and prepare meals in advance. So many people fail to achieve their weight loss goals because they aren’t prepared.
It’s as simple as setting out your workout clothes the night before. Shop for fruits and veggies in advance so that you can have easy access to these foods rather than grabbing for foods that work against the goals you have set for yourself.
Make Exercise Fun
Do the types of exercise that are fun. You should look forward to working out rather than just trying to get through it. You can mix it up. In fact, it’s recommended that you vary your workouts on different days. This works in your favor because you won’t get bored and it challenges different muscle groups.
Spin class is a great exercise that a lot of people flock to. If you like the idea of riding a stationary bike to great music this may be the exercise for you too. There are so many different exercises to choose from that there really isn’t any excuse not to work out. You are encouraged to try as many as necessary to find what works for you.
Circuit training is another popular workout program that combines interval training designed to work your entire body.
Track Your Success
Set short and long term goals. A good idea is to set milestones such as three, six and 12 month goals. These will be your check points to celebrate and to tweak your workout plan as needed.
Ensure your New Years resolutions are achievable by starting with small attainable steps and work your way up to more advanced steps. Don’t get tempted by the hype or the next fitness craze. Stick to sensible goals and you will see results. It’s more about consistency than hard work. Over a short period of time you will begin to see results.
